Browse our selection of linen fabric sold by the yard. Known for its durability and strength, linen is made of natural fibers derived from the stems of the flax plant. It is highly absorbent, breathable, and gets softer with each wash, making it a popular choice for household items such as bedding, curtains, tablecloths, and upholstery. It's also often used for lightweight clothing to keep the body cool and comfortable in warmer climates. Linen's versatility makes it a go-to fabric for many sewing enthusiasts.

Linen fabric, made from the fibers of the flax plant, is known for being durable and breathable. Linen is conventionally used for warm weather apparel because of this. Other uses for linen include hand embroidery projects, tablecloths, towels, napkins, and window treatments. We have a wonderful selection of linen fabric in a range of colors and patterns.
